How they compare

Ecuador currently reports 367.34 1000 USD against 332.72 1000 USD in Honduras, a difference of 34.62 1000 USD.

That makes Ecuador's figure about 1.1 times Honduras's.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 5 shared years of data; in 2017 it was Honduras ahead.

Ecuador ranks 23rd and Honduras ranks 26th of 82 countries.

Across the 2 decades both report, Ecuador averaged higher in 1 and Honduras in 1.

The Fertilizers by Product dataset contains information on the Production, Trade and Agriculture Use of inorganic (chemical or mineral) fertilizers products. The fertilizer statistics data are for a set of 23 product categories. Both straight and compound fertilizers are included.
